Introduction
Choosing the right cloud server provider is a crucial decision that can significantly impact your business operations, costs, and overall efficiency. With a myriad of options available, it’s essential to understand what each provider offers and how it aligns with your specific needs. This article will guide you through the process of selecting the best cloud server provider, highlighting key factors to consider and providing an overview of popular providers.
Understanding Cloud Server Providers
Cloud server providers offer virtualized computing resources over the internet. These services include storage, processing power, and networking capabilities, which can be scaled up or down based on demand. There are various types of cloud server providers, including public, private, and hybrid cloud providers, each offering different levels of control, security, and flexibility.
Key Factors to Consider
When choosing a cloud server provider, several critical factors must be evaluated to ensure you make the best decision for your needs.
- Performance and Reliability
The performance and reliability of a cloud server provider are paramount. Look for providers with high uptime guarantees and robust performance metrics to ensure your applications run smoothly and are always available. - Security Measures
Security is a top concern for any business. Ensure the provider offers strong data encryption, compliance with industry standards, and robust access controls to protect your sensitive information. - Scalability and Flexibility
Choose a provider that offers scalable resources, allowing you to adjust your computing power, storage, and bandwidth as your needs evolve. Flexibility in deployment options and global data center availability is also crucial. - Cost and Pricing Models
Understand the pricing models offered by different providers. Look for transparent pricing, cost predictability, and flexible payment options such as pay-as-you-go or reserved instances. - Customer Support and Service Level Agreements (SLAs)
Reliable customer support and comprehensive SLAs are essential for addressing issues quickly and ensuring service quality. Evaluate the support options available, including response times and the expertise of the support team.
Popular Cloud Server Providers
Several cloud server providers stand out due to their comprehensive offerings, reliability, and market presence. Let’s explore some of the top providers.
Amazon Web Services (AWS)
- Introduction to AWS
Amazon Web Services (AWS) is a leading cloud server provider, known for its extensive range of services and global infrastructure. - Key Features and Benefits
AWS offers a vast array of services, including computing power, storage, databases, machine learning, and analytics. Its global network of data centers ensures high availability and low latency. - Pricing Model
AWS uses a pay-as-you-go pricing model, allowing businesses to pay only for the resources they use. It also offers reserved instances for cost savings on long-term commitments.
Microsoft Azure
- Introduction to Azure
Microsoft Azure is a prominent cloud platform offering a broad range of services designed for businesses of all sizes. - Key Features and Benefits
Azure integrates seamlessly with Microsoft’s software ecosystem, making it an excellent choice for businesses using Windows and other Microsoft products. It provides robust AI and machine learning capabilities, as well as strong hybrid cloud options. - Pricing Model
Azure offers flexible pricing models, including pay-as-you-go, reserved instances, and hybrid benefits for businesses with existing Microsoft licenses.
Google Cloud Platform (GCP)
- Introduction to GCP
Google Cloud Platform (GCP) is known for its strong data analytics and machine learning services, leveraging Google’s expertise in these areas. - Key Features and Benefits
GCP offers advanced data processing capabilities, robust security features, and a global network of data centers. It’s an excellent choice for data-intensive applications and big data analytics. - Pricing Model
GCP provides transparent pricing with pay-as-you-go options and sustained use discounts for long-term usage. - Other Notable Providers
While AWS, Azure, and GCP are the most prominent providers, other notable options include: - IBM Cloud
IBM Cloud offers strong AI and machine learning services, as well as robust security features. - Oracle Cloud
Oracle Cloud is known for its enterprise-grade database services and strong integration with Oracle applications. - Alibaba Cloud
Alibaba Cloud is a leading provider in Asia, offering comprehensive cloud services and strong support for businesses in the region. - Performance and Reliability
Performance and reliability are critical factors in choosing a cloud server provider. Look for providers with high uptime guarantees (typically 99.9% or higher) and robust performance metrics, such as low latency and high throughput. - Security Measures
Security is a top priority for cloud server providers. Ensure the provider offers strong data encryption, compliance with industry standards (such as ISO 27001 and GDPR), and robust access controls to protect your sensitive information. - Scalability and Flexibility
Scalability and flexibility are essential for accommodating changing business needs. Look for providers that offer elastic resource allocation, allowing you to scale up or down based on demand. Global data center availability is also crucial for ensuring low latency and high availability. - Cost and Pricing Models
Understanding the cost and pricing models of cloud server providers is essential for managing expenses. Look for transparent pricing, cost predictability, and flexible payment options, such as pay-as-you-go or reserved instances. Free tiers can also be beneficial for testing services before committing to a provider. - Customer Support and SLAs
Reliable customer support and comprehensive SLAs are crucial for addressing issues quickly and ensuring service quality. Evaluate the support options available, including response times, expertise of the support team, and the terms of the SLAs. - Making the Final Decision
To make the best decision, assess your specific needs, such as performance, security, scalability, and cost. Compare the features and offerings of different providers to determine which one aligns best with your requirements. Consider using a trial period or free tier to test the services before making a long-term commitment.
Conclusion
Choosing the right cloud server provider is a crucial decision that can significantly impact your business operations and overall efficiency. By carefully evaluating performance, security, scalability, cost, and support options, you can select the provider that best meets your needs and helps you achieve your business goals.
FAQs
- What is the most important factor when choosing a cloud server provider?
The most important factor is understanding your specific needs and evaluating how well a provider’s offerings align with those needs, including performance, security, scalability, and cost. - How do cloud server providers ensure data security?
Cloud server providers ensure data security through robust encryption, compliance with industry standards, and strong access controls to protect sensitive information. - Can I switch between cloud server providers easily?
Switching between cloud server providers can be challenging due to potential compatibility issues and data migration complexities. It’s essential to plan and evaluate the feasibility before making a switch. - What are the hidden costs of cloud servers?
Hidden costs can include data transfer fees, charges for additional services, and costs associated with scaling resources. It’s important to understand the full pricing model of a provider to avoid unexpected expenses. - How can I assess the performance of a cloud server provider?
Assess performance by evaluating uptime guarantees, latency, throughput, and other performance metrics. Many providers offer tools and reports to help monitor and assess performance.